On Thu, 3 Feb 2000, Aaron Konstam wrote:
> Recently there was a note about a pam module that aids in simultanious
> rebuilding of the passwd database. I lost the message and this is something we
> are having problems with.
> When we do bulk passwd file updates we have race condition problems. Could
> someone repost the information or point me to a mail list archive?
Which module do you use for password updates? pam_unix, pam_pwdb?
There is still a race condition in pam_unix as of PAM 0.72. If this is what
you're using, let me know, I can put together a patch and post it to the
list.
